Healthy Blueberry Chia Seed Jam Recipe (No Refined Sugar)

Ingredients

Scale

2 cups Blueberries, fresh or frozen

2 tbsp Honey

1 tsp Lemon Juice

2 tbsp Chia Seeds


Instructions

 1. Prep the Fruit - If using fresh blueberries, wash and dry berries.

 2. Make the Berry Jam Base - In a medium saucepan, combine the blueberries, honey and lemon juice. Bring to a boil on medium high heat. Turn down the heat and simmer for 10 - 15 minutes or until the blueberries have cooked down. (If you are using fresh blueberries this might only take 5 - 10 minutes.) Use a potato masher or a metal spoon to ‘mash’ the berries to your desired consistency. (If you prefer a smoother consistency, you can also use an immersion blender to puree the blueberry jam mixture.)

 3. Add the Chia Seeds - Remove the jam from the heat and stir in the chia seeds. The jam will thicken as it cools.

 4. Serving and Storage - Serve your homemade blueberry jam with warm toast, pancakes, oatmeal, yogurt or over vanilla ice cream. Or store for later, allow the jam to cool before transferring to a sterilized glass jar or an airtight container. This Blueberry Chia Jam will last for a week in the refrigerator or can be frozen for up to 3 months.

 

Notes

Fridge: Store the chia jam in clean jars or an airtight container for up to a week.

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the jam for up to 3 months. It's a great way to extend its shelf life without sacrificing taste.

Meal Prep Tip: Freeze the jam in small batches. This approach allows you to defrost only what you need, reducing waste and ensuring freshness.

How to Defrost Chia Jam: To defrost, thaw it in the fridge overnight or on the countertop for an hour or two. Once defrosted, transfer the jam to the refrigerator. Give your blueberry jam a good stir before using.
